Pressmen Pay Wages – Northeast 1850

In 1850, a pressman in the Northeast earned roughly $1.58 per day, or about $493 annually. Pressmen were critical for the burgeoning newspaper and book industry, operating printing presses that brought the latest news and literature to the public—however, their wages meant that even the simplest comfort, such as a new vest at $2.30, was a significant expense.
